Benjamin Shull of The Wall Street Journal recently reviewed Barrel-Aged Stout and Selling Out, stating, "As for the book's centerpiece—the story of Anheuser's purchase of Goose—nobody is more qualified to tell it than Mr. Noel, since he broke the news of the sale for the Chicago Tribune." Check out this shout-out for Barrel-Aged Stout and Selling Out featured in an article by Jim Vorel from Paste Magazine!: "I also found myself appreciating, as I tucked into the book, that it functions both as a history and as an illuminating look into how the world’s largest beer conglomerate tends to do business...in the course of reading, I was entertained and informed in equal measure."
In a new review of Barrel-Aged Stout and Selling Out, Kirkus says “Fans of good beer will enjoy Noel’s explorations, which make for a useful cautionary tale as well.”
